read the original abstract
The purpose of this overview is to explain the enormous impact of Les Valiant's eponymous short conference contribution from 1979 on the development of algebraic complexity.

Quantum determinants in polynomial time
The q-Cayley determinant of q-right-quantum matrices equals a Valiant-style clow determinant and is computable by a polynomial-size algebraic branching program.
